Scottish Schools Primary Team Chess Championship 2007-2008
The Chess Scotland Primary Team Championship has been running for over 20 years and is open to all Scottish Primary Schools. In addition to the main Primary Team Championship there is a separate competition for younger "P5 & Under" teams. (This does not mean that younger pupils are excluded from the main Primary Team Championship: they may play as part of a school’s primary team, or may even enter the main Championship as an entire team, if they wish.)
A school may enter one or more teams, each of 4 players, arranged in order of playing strength. There will be two stages to the competition: a local first round and a national final. There will be up to 8 first round sections, depending on how many teams enter. To minimise travel, first-round sections will be based on broad geographical areas, with matches arranged in a central location, convenient for the schools in each section.
In general, all first-round matches will be played on a Saturday or Sunday between January and March. Dates and venues for each section will be arranged locally once the total number of entries is known.
Depending on the number of teams entering, the first-round heat may take the form of an “All-play-All” or "Swiss" team tournament. Both the Winners and Runners-up from each section will go through to the national final. In the event of ties for first or second place, tie-breaking rules will be applied.

The final stage of the competition will take place in April or May 2008 at a central location. This will be a 5-round "Swiss" team tournament. Both the Primary Team Championship Final and the "P5&Under" Team Championships Final will be held at the same venue on the same day.
